Output 3addc51b260589b7cea2f7d85debbf9c54eb9bb5546507bb0bbd53b2b20d1b54:0

value
999943000
script pubkey
OP_0 OP_PUSHBYTES_20 904edb5445d37d1a16807da9a94544b1767af7d9
address
bc1qjp8dk4z96d73595q0k56j32yk9m84a7e480vpy
transaction
3addc51b260589b7cea2f7d85debbf9c54eb9bb5546507bb0bbd53b2b20d1b54
confirmations
138867
spent
true